{"id":477604,"date":"2023-08-09T09:17:42","date_gmt":"2023-08-09T09:17:42","guid":{"rendered":""},"modified":"2023-09-05T11:15:05","modified_gmt":"2023-09-05T11:15:05","slug":"inline-frame","status":"publish","type":"wiki","link":"https:\/\/oneproxy.pro\/es\/wiki\/inline-frame\/","title":{"rendered":"marco en l\u00ednea"},"content":{"rendered":"<h2>Introducci\u00f3n<\/h2>\n<p>Un marco en l\u00ednea (IFrame) es un elemento HTML que se utiliza para incrustar otro documento HTML dentro del documento actual. Permite la integraci\u00f3n perfecta de contenido externo, como p\u00e1ginas web o medios, en un sitio web. Este art\u00edculo profundiza en la historia, la funcionalidad, los tipos, las aplicaciones y las perspectivas futuras de Inline Frames, centr\u00e1ndose en su relevancia para el sitio web de OneProxy, un reconocido proveedor de servidores proxy.<\/p>\n<h2>Historia y Primera Menci\u00f3n<\/h2>\n<p>El concepto de Inline Frames surgi\u00f3 junto con el desarrollo de HTML a finales de los a\u00f1os 1990. El Consorcio World Wide Web (W3C) introdujo el elemento IFrame en HTML 4.0 y r\u00e1pidamente gan\u00f3 popularidad debido a su capacidad para incrustar contenido externo en una p\u00e1gina web. Esta caracter\u00edstica innovadora revolucion\u00f3 el dise\u00f1o web y la presentaci\u00f3n de contenido, permitiendo sitios web m\u00e1s din\u00e1micos e interactivos.<\/p>\n<h2>Informaci\u00f3n detallada sobre el marco en l\u00ednea<\/h2>\n<p>Un marco en l\u00ednea act\u00faa como un contenedor para mostrar un documento HTML independiente dentro de un documento principal. Funciona como una ventana a trav\u00e9s de la cual se puede ver el contenido externo, ofreciendo una experiencia de navegaci\u00f3n perfecta. El elemento IFrame admite varios atributos para controlar su apariencia, dimensiones y comportamiento, lo que lo hace vers\u00e1til y personalizable.<\/p>\n<h2>Estructura interna y funcionalidad<\/h2>\n<p>El marco en l\u00ednea funciona como un elemento de nivel en l\u00ednea dentro del flujo del documento principal, permitiendo que otros elementos lo rodeen e interact\u00faen con \u00e9l. Contiene su propio modelo de objetos de documento (DOM) independiente, lo que significa que puede alojar su JavaScript, estilos y otros recursos sin interferir con el c\u00f3digo del documento principal. La independencia del IFrame evita conflictos entre los dos documentos, garantizando estabilidad y seguridad.<\/p>\n<h2>Caracter\u00edsticas clave del marco en l\u00ednea<\/h2>\n<p>El elemento IFrame cuenta con varias caracter\u00edsticas clave que contribuyen a su adopci\u00f3n y usabilidad generalizadas. Algunas caracter\u00edsticas notables incluyen:<\/p>\n<ol>\n<li><strong>Integraci\u00f3n perfecta<\/strong>: Los IFrames permiten mostrar contenido externo dentro de una p\u00e1gina web sin afectar el dise\u00f1o o el rendimiento general.<\/li>\n<li><strong>Contenido din\u00e1mico<\/strong>: Permite actualizaciones en tiempo real y carga din\u00e1mica de contenido actualizando o cambiando el contenido dentro del marco sin recargar toda la p\u00e1gina.<\/li>\n<li><strong>Capacidades entre dominios<\/strong>: Los IFrames facilitan la comunicaci\u00f3n entre dominios, lo que los hace adecuados para incrustar contenido de terceros de forma segura.<\/li>\n<li><strong>F\u00e1cil implementaci\u00f3n<\/strong>: La integraci\u00f3n de un IFrame es relativamente sencilla y requiere una experiencia m\u00ednima en codificaci\u00f3n.<\/li>\n<\/ol>\n<h2>Tipos de marco en l\u00ednea<\/h2>\n<p>Los Inline Frames se pueden clasificar seg\u00fan su uso y contenido. A continuaci\u00f3n se muestran los tipos comunes de IFrames:<\/p>\n<table>\n<thead>\n<tr>\n<th>Tipo<\/th>\n<th>Descripci\u00f3n<\/th>\n<\/tr>\n<\/thead>\n<tbody>\n<tr>\n<td><strong>Incrustaci\u00f3n de contenido<\/strong><\/td>\n<td>El tipo m\u00e1s com\u00fan, utilizado para incrustar p\u00e1ginas web externas, v\u00eddeos, mapas u otros medios en una p\u00e1gina web anfitriona.<\/td>\n<\/tr>\n<tr>\n<td><strong>pancartas publicitarias<\/strong><\/td>\n<td>Los IFrames se utilizan a menudo para mostrar anuncios de fuentes externas manteniendo un contexto de documento separado.<\/td>\n<\/tr>\n<tr>\n<td><strong>Env\u00edo de formulario<\/strong><\/td>\n<td>Se emplea para enviar formularios o realizar acciones espec\u00edficas de forma asincr\u00f3nica sin recargar toda la p\u00e1gina.<\/td>\n<\/tr>\n<tr>\n<td><strong>Zona de seguridad de seguridad<\/strong><\/td>\n<td>Los IFrames act\u00faan como medida de seguridad aislando el contenido potencialmente malicioso de la p\u00e1gina principal, impidiendo el acceso no autorizado.<\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<h2>Formas de utilizar marcos en l\u00ednea, problemas y soluciones<\/h2>\n<p>IFrames ofrece una gran cantidad de aplicaciones para desarrolladores web y creadores de contenido. Algunos casos de uso comunes incluyen:<\/p>\n<ol>\n<li><strong>Integraci\u00f3n de contenido externo<\/strong>: La incorporaci\u00f3n de contenido externo de fuentes acreditadas, como widgets meteorol\u00f3gicos, feeds de redes sociales o art\u00edculos de noticias, mejora la experiencia del usuario.<\/li>\n<li><strong>Visualizaci\u00f3n de anuncios<\/strong>: Los IFrames facilitan la visualizaci\u00f3n de anuncios de redes publicitarias, generando ingresos para los propietarios de sitios web.<\/li>\n<li><strong>Aislamiento de datos<\/strong>: IFrames puede aislar datos confidenciales o componentes de terceros, lo que reduce el riesgo de violaciones de datos y mantiene la seguridad general del sitio web.<\/li>\n<\/ol>\n<p>Sin embargo, el uso de IFrames no est\u00e1 exento de desaf\u00edos. Algunos problemas y sus soluciones incluyen:<\/p>\n<ol>\n<li><strong>Problemas entre or\u00edgenes<\/strong>: Las restricciones de uso compartido de recursos entre or\u00edgenes (CORS) pueden impedir la comunicaci\u00f3n entre el IFrame y la p\u00e1gina principal. La implementaci\u00f3n de encabezados CORS en el lado del servidor puede resolver este problema.<\/li>\n<li><strong>Limitaciones de estilo<\/strong>: Los IFrames pueden heredar algunos estilos del documento principal, lo que genera inconsistencias en el dise\u00f1o. Definir estilos expl\u00edcitamente dentro del IFrame puede solucionar este problema.<\/li>\n<li><strong>Impacto en el rendimiento<\/strong>: Cargar varios IFrames con contenido pesado puede afectar el rendimiento del sitio web. Optimizar el contenido y utilizar t\u00e9cnicas de carga diferida puede mitigar este impacto.<\/li>\n<\/ol>\n<h2>Principales caracter\u00edsticas y comparaciones<\/h2>\n<p>Comparemos IFrames con otros elementos similares:<\/p>\n<table>\n<thead>\n<tr>\n<th>Elemento<\/th>\n<th>Caracter\u00edsticas<\/th>\n<th>Comparaci\u00f3n<\/th>\n<\/tr>\n<\/thead>\n<tbody>\n<tr>\n<td><strong>marco flotante<\/strong><\/td>\n<td>\u2013 Incrusta contenido externo.<\/td>\n<td>\u2013 Permite una integraci\u00f3n perfecta de contenido externo.<\/td>\n<\/tr>\n<tr>\n<td><\/td>\n<td>\u2013 Proporciona aislamiento por seguridad.<\/td>\n<td>\u2013 Previene conflictos entre los documentos principales y los incrustados.<\/td>\n<\/tr>\n<tr>\n<td><\/td>\n<td>\u2013 Admite actualizaciones de contenido en tiempo real.<\/td>\n<td>\u2013 Permite la carga din\u00e1mica de contenido sin necesidad de actualizar la p\u00e1gina completa.<\/td>\n<\/tr>\n<tr>\n<td><strong>Empotrar<\/strong><\/td>\n<td>\u2013 Tambi\u00e9n incorpora contenido externo.<\/td>\n<td>\u2013 Limitado en t\u00e9rminos de personalizaci\u00f3n e interacci\u00f3n con el contenido.<\/td>\n<\/tr>\n<tr>\n<td><\/td>\n<td>\u2013 Generalmente carece de aislamiento de seguridad.<\/td>\n<td>\u2013 Afecta directamente los estilos y el dise\u00f1o del documento principal.<\/td>\n<\/tr>\n<tr>\n<td><strong>Objeto<\/strong><\/td>\n<td>\u2013 Incrusta contenido multimedia (por ejemplo, v\u00eddeos).<\/td>\n<td>\u2013 Ofrece menos flexibilidad en t\u00e9rminos de tipos de contenido.<\/td>\n<\/tr>\n<tr>\n<td><\/td>\n<td>\u2013 Puede requerir complementos del navegador para la reproducci\u00f3n.<\/td>\n<td>\u2013 Se utiliza con menos frecuencia para incrustar contenido general.<\/td>\n<\/tr>\n<\/tbody>\n<\/table>\n<h2>Perspectivas y tecnolog\u00edas futuras<\/h2>\n<p>De cara al futuro, es probable que los Inline Frames sigan siendo un elemento b\u00e1sico en el desarrollo web debido a su versatilidad y practicidad. Sin embargo, las nuevas tecnolog\u00edas y est\u00e1ndares pueden mejorar a\u00fan m\u00e1s sus capacidades. Una de esas tecnolog\u00edas emergentes son los componentes web, cuyo objetivo es simplificar el desarrollo web proporcionando elementos personalizados reutilizables. La integraci\u00f3n de componentes web con IFrames puede generar soluciones web a\u00fan m\u00e1s potentes y modulares.<\/p>\n<h2>Servidores proxy y asociaci\u00f3n de marcos en l\u00ednea<\/h2>\n<p>Los servidores proxy, como los proporcionados por OneProxy, pueden asociarse estrechamente con IFrames, especialmente en escenarios que requieren una incrustaci\u00f3n segura de contenido. Los servidores proxy act\u00faan como intermediarios entre los usuarios y los servidores web, mejorando la privacidad, la seguridad y el acceso al contenido bloqueado. Al combinar IFrames con servidores proxy, los propietarios de sitios web pueden garantizar capas adicionales de seguridad al enrutar el contenido incrustado a trav\u00e9s del proxy, salvaguardando los datos de los usuarios y manteniendo el anonimato.<\/p>\n<h2>enlaces relacionados<\/h2>\n<p>Para obtener m\u00e1s informaci\u00f3n sobre Inline Frames y sus aplicaciones, consulte los siguientes recursos:<\/p>\n<ul>\n<li><a href=\"https:\/\/html.spec.whatwg.org\/multipage\/iframe-embed-object.html#iframe\" target=\"_new\" rel=\"noopener nofollow\">Est\u00e1ndar de vida HTML del W3C: marcos en l\u00ednea<\/a><\/li>\n<li><a href=\"https:\/\/developer.mozilla.org\/en-US\/docs\/Web\/HTML\/Element\/iframe\" target=\"_new\" rel=\"noopener nofollow\">MDN Web Docs: elemento de marco en l\u00ednea<\/a><\/li>\n<li><a href=\"https:\/\/developer.mozilla.org\/en-US\/docs\/Web\/Web_Components\" target=\"_new\" rel=\"noopener nofollow\">Componentes web \u2013 Documentos web de MDN<\/a><\/li>\n<\/ul>\n<p>En conclusi\u00f3n, los Inline Frames (IFrames) han desempe\u00f1ado un papel importante en la configuraci\u00f3n del desarrollo web moderno al permitir una integraci\u00f3n perfecta de contenido y experiencias de usuario din\u00e1micas. Con sus numerosas aplicaciones y potencial para avances futuros, IFrames seguir\u00e1 siendo un activo valioso para los dise\u00f1adores y desarrolladores web, incluidos aquellos que buscan mejorar sus servicios de servidor proxy, como OneProxy.<\/p>","protected":false},"featured_media":477605,"menu_order":0,"template":"","meta":{"_acf_changed":false,"content-type":"","inline_featured_image":false,"footnotes":""},"class_list":["post-477604","wiki","type-wiki","status-publish","has-post-thumbnail","hentry"],"acf":{"faq_title":"Frequently Asked Questions about <mark>Inline Frame (IFrame) for the Website of the Proxy Server Provider OneProxy (oneproxy.pro)<\/mark>","faq_items":[{"question":"What is an Inline Frame (IFrame)?","answer":"<p>An Inline Frame (IFrame) is an HTML element used to embed another HTML document within the current document, allowing seamless integration of external content, such as web pages or media, into a website.<\/p>"},{"question":"When and where was the IFrame first introduced?","answer":"<p>The concept of Inline Frames emerged alongside the development of HTML in the late 1990s. The World Wide Web Consortium (W3C) introduced the IFrame element in HTML 4.0, and it quickly gained popularity for its ability to embed external content into a webpage.<\/p>"},{"question":"How does an Inline Frame work?","answer":"<p>An Inline Frame acts as a container for displaying an independent HTML document within a parent document. It operates as an inline-level element within the parent document's flow and contains its own independent Document Object Model (DOM), preventing conflicts and ensuring stability and security.<\/p>"},{"question":"What are the key features of Inline Frames?","answer":"<p>IFrames offer several key features, including seamless content integration, dynamic content updates, cross-domain capabilities, and easy implementation for web developers.<\/p>"},{"question":"What types of Inline Frames exist?","answer":"<p>Inline Frames can be categorized based on their usage and content, such as content embedding, ad banners, form submission, and security sandbox IFrames.<\/p>"},{"question":"How can I use Inline Frames on my website?","answer":"<p>You can use Inline Frames to embed external content, display advertisements, submit forms asynchronously, and enhance security by isolating sensitive data or third-party components.<\/p>"},{"question":"What are the common problems with using Inline Frames?","answer":"<p>Common problems include cross-origin issues, styling limitations, and potential performance impact. Solutions involve implementing CORS headers, explicitly defining styles within the IFrame, and optimizing content with lazy loading techniques.<\/p>"},{"question":"How do Inline Frames compare to other elements like Embed and Object?","answer":"<p>Inline Frames offer more versatility and customization compared to simpler embedding elements like Embed and provide better isolation and real-time content updates compared to Object elements.<\/p>"},{"question":"What does the future hold for Inline Frames?","answer":"<p>Inline Frames are expected to remain a crucial element in web development. Integrating them with emerging technologies like Web Components may lead to even more powerful and modular web solutions.<\/p>"},{"question":"How are proxy servers associated with Inline Frames?","answer":"<p>Proxy servers, like those provided by OneProxy, can be closely associated with IFrames, especially for secure content embedding. Proxy servers act as intermediaries, enhancing privacy, security, and access to blocked content when combined with IFrames.<\/p>"}]},"_links":{"self":[{"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/wiki\/477604","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/wiki"}],"about":[{"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/types\/wiki"}],"version-history":[{"count":0,"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/wiki\/477604\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/media\/477605"}],"wp:attachment":[{"href":"https:\/\/oneproxy.pro\/es\/wp-json\/wp\/v2\/media?parent=477604"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}